A liquid cooling system Technical Field

[0001] This application relates to the field of heat dissipation technology for electrical components, and more specifically, to a liquid cooling system. Background Technology

[0002] The data center liquid cooling system consists of the cooling object, secondary side piping system, heat exchange unit (CDU), primary side piping system, Manifold, main control system, etc., and can achieve efficient heat dissipation of the cold plate system.

[0003] Heat exchange unit (CDU): The CDU system is powered by a water pump to provide the cooling medium. It transfers the heat from the secondary-side ICT equipment to the primary side within a plate heat exchanger, where it is carried away by primary-side heat dissipation equipment such as cooling towers or chillers.

[0004] It is evident that CDU (Channel Cooling Unit) equipment is the core component of a data center liquid cooling system. However, current CDUs on the market are all single-channel liquid supply systems, which does not meet the requirements for online maintenance. This means that any component failure in a CDU necessitates system shutdown for repair, making routine maintenance extremely inconvenient. Secondly, large and medium-sized projects typically involve significant heat exchange, requiring multiple plate heat exchangers. Current CDU equipment on the market only has one heat exchanger, failing to allow for customized configuration based on project load. Simply piling up multiple CDUs to meet requirements increases the overall project cost. Summary of the Invention

[0005] This application provides a liquid cooling system to solve the problems of existing liquid cooling systems that generally use a single-path liquid supply and return system, where failure or leakage at any location can cause the entire equipment to become unusable and daily maintenance is inconvenient.

[0035] In one specific implementation, the liquid cooling system includes a liquid-cooled server, a heat dissipation module, and a cooling capacity distribution module.

[0036] The cooling capacity distribution module includes several heat exchanger units 1. Each heat exchanger unit 1 includes a heat exchanger 1, a primary side liquid inlet pipe 2 and a primary side liquid return pipe 3 that form a circulation pipeline connected to the heat dissipation module and the primary side of the heat exchanger 1, and a secondary side liquid supply pipe 4 and a secondary side liquid return pipe 5 that form a circulation pipeline connected to the liquid cooling server and the secondary side of the heat exchanger 1. The primary side liquid inlet pipes 2, the primary side liquid return pipes 3, the secondary side liquid supply pipes 4, and the secondary side liquid return pipes 5 are respectively connected in parallel via double valves.

[0037] Each heat exchanger unit 1 has its primary side connected to the heat dissipation module and its secondary side connected to the liquid-cooled server. A secondary-side pump drives the high-temperature return water into the secondary-side circulation pipeline, which then enters each heat exchanger unit 1 to indirectly exchange heat with the low-temperature water on the primary side. This process reduces the high-temperature water on the secondary side to the low-temperature water required by the liquid-cooled server and other terminal equipment. Specifically, the primary-side inlet pipeline 2 is connected to the liquid supply end of the heat dissipation module, and the primary-side return pipeline 3 is connected to the return end of the heat dissipation module; the secondary-side supply pipeline 4 is connected to the liquid supply end of the liquid-cooled server, and the secondary-side return pipeline 5 is connected to the return end of the liquid-cooled server.

[0038] It is understandable that the pipes of several heat exchanger units 1 are connected in parallel. Taking a cooling capacity distribution module with 4 heat exchanger units 1 as an example, each heat exchanger unit 1 has a primary side inlet pipe 2, a primary side return pipe 3, a secondary side supply pipe 4, and a secondary side return pipe 5. Among them, the 4 primary side inlet pipes 2 are connected in parallel through the primary side main inlet pipe, and two valves are installed between two adjacent primary side inlet pipes 2 on the primary side main inlet pipe. Similarly, the 4 primary side return pipes 3 are connected in parallel through the primary side main return pipe, specifically, two valves are installed between two adjacent primary side return pipes 3 on the primary side main return pipe. Four secondary-side liquid supply lines 4 are connected in parallel via a secondary-side main liquid inlet line. Specifically, two valves are installed between two adjacent secondary-side liquid supply lines 4 on the secondary-side main liquid inlet line. Four secondary-side liquid return lines 5 are connected in parallel via a secondary-side main liquid return line. Specifically, two valves are installed between two adjacent secondary-side liquid return lines 5 on the secondary-side main liquid return line. The valves mentioned above are control valves. When any component fails or leakage occurs at any point, the system can be shut down through the valves. Online maintenance can be performed without shutting down the terminal equipment, and online replacement of system components is possible. The above liquid cooling system has strong flexibility, redundancy, and ease of maintenance.

[0039] The liquid-cooled server has a server rack, which is connected to the secondary side liquid supply line 4 and the secondary side liquid return line 5 respectively; the heat dissipation module includes a cooling tower and a water pump, and the heat exchanger unit 1 forms a primary side loop through the primary side liquid inlet line 2, the primary side liquid return line 3, the cooling tower and the water pump.

[0040] Specifically, a first valve 6 is provided on any primary side inlet pipe 2, a second valve 7 is provided on any primary side return pipe 3, a third valve 8 is provided on any secondary side supply pipe 4, and a fourth valve 9 is provided on any secondary side return pipe 5. This arrangement allows for the shut-off of leaks at any point on the pipelines via the corresponding valves, enabling online maintenance without shutting down the terminal equipment. The first valve 6, second valve 7, third valve 8, and fourth valve 9 can have the same structure for ease of installation. Furthermore, each valve can be configured as a control valve, such as a solenoid valve, to facilitate intelligent control. In other embodiments, appropriate valves can be provided as needed, as long as the same technical effect is achieved.

[0050] Furthermore, a first transmission device 16, a seventh valve 17, and an eighth valve 18 are respectively installed on the secondary server return pipeline 15. The seventh valve 17 and the eighth valve 18 are respectively located on both sides of the first transmission device 16 so that the pipeline can be effectively shut off in a timely manner when a leak occurs. At the same time, a ninth valve 19 is installed on the secondary server inlet pipeline 14 to further effectively shut off the pipeline in the event of a leak.

[0051] To improve system safety, the primary-side heat dissipation equipment supply pipe 10 and the primary-side heat dissipation equipment return pipe 11 are each in two sets; the secondary-side server inlet pipe 14 and the secondary-side server return pipe 15 are each in two sets. Preferably, the first set of the primary-side heat dissipation equipment supply pipe 10, primary-side heat dissipation equipment return pipe 11, secondary-side server inlet pipe 14, and secondary-side server return pipe 15 is located at the position corresponding to the first heat exchanger unit among the four heat exchanger units, and the second set of the primary-side heat dissipation equipment supply pipe 10, primary-side heat dissipation equipment return pipe 11, secondary-side server inlet pipe 14, and secondary-side server return pipe 15 is located at the position corresponding to the fourth heat exchanger unit among the four heat exchanger units, so that the system is reasonably distributed and easy to maintain.

[0052] The above system adopts a modular structure. The heat exchanger unit 1, the secondary server inlet pipeline 14, and the secondary server return pipeline 15 can be replaced with modules of different specifications and models according to different project requirements, or modules can be added or removed, such as heat exchanger unit 1, pump group, or valve and instrument module. At the same time, the installation position of each module is designed to facilitate replacement and maintenance, which has strong flexibility, redundancy and easy maintenance.
